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: Patients with breast, gynecological and urology cancer in the age range of 18-80 years with complaints of peripheral neuropathy symptoms, according to the opinion of a neurologist; their neuropathy is due to chemotherapy with taxane drugs. Are undergoing chemotherapy or have a history of chemotherapy, provided that no more than two months have passed since the completion of their chemotherapy, regardless of the number of chemotherapy courses.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: Having diabetes and other neuropathies such as Guillain-Barré, multiple sclerosis, and carpal tunnel syndrome Allergy to herbal medicines Stage 4 cancer patients Patients who perform radiotherapy at the same time as chemotherapy
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| Sensory and motor disorders and pain and symptoms of neuropathy in the lower and upper limbs. Timepoint: The beginning of the study (before the start of the intervention) and 28 days after the start of topical herbal oil consumption (the end of the intervention). Method of measurement: To quantitatively evaluate peripheral neuropathy before and after intervention(Questionnaire FACT/GOG-Ntx Version 4)Functional Assessment of Cancer Therapy for patients with neurotoxicity questionnaire - version 4 (FACT-GOG-NTX), Qualitative symptoms of peripheral neuropathy based on the scalePNQ (Patient Neurotoxicity Questionnaire), Pain before and after the intervention; Neuropathic Pain Scale (NPS). | — |
